Author: rmannibucau
Date: Mon Sep 12 18:26:19 2011
New Revision: 1169858
URL: http://svn.apache.org/viewvc?rev=1169858&view=rev
Log:
trying to print code a bit better
Modified:
openejb/trunk/sandbox/tools/src/main/java/org/apache/openejb/tools/examples/GenerateIndex.java
Modified:
openejb/trunk/sandbox/tools/src/main/java/org/apache/openejb/tools/examples/GenerateIndex.java
URL:
http://svn.apache.org/viewvc/openejb/trunk/sandbox/tools/src/main/java/org/apache/openejb/tools/examples/GenerateIndex.java?rev=1169858&r1=1169857&r2=1169858&view=diff
==============================================================================
---
openejb/trunk/sandbox/tools/src/main/java/org/apache/openejb/tools/examples/GenerateIndex.java
(original)
+++
openejb/trunk/sandbox/tools/src/main/java/org/apache/openejb/tools/examples/GenerateIndex.java
Mon Sep 12 18:26:19 2011
@@ -135,12 +135,20 @@ public class GenerateIndex {
if (readme.exists()) {
try {
String content = FileUtils.readFileToString(readme);
+ html = PROCESSOR.markdown(content);
// auto link examples
// all example names should start with a space in the
md if it was not already replaced
- for (Map.Entry<String, String>
exampleName : exampleNames.entrySet()){
- content =
content.replace(" " + exampleName.getKey(), " <a href=\"" +
exampleName.getValue() + "\">" + exampleName.getKey() + "</a>");
- }
- html = PROCESSOR.markdown(content);
+ for (Map.Entry<String, String> exampleName :
exampleNames.entrySet()){
+ content = content.replace(" " +
exampleName.getKey(), " <a href=\"" + exampleName.getValue() + "\">" +
exampleName.getKey() + "</a>");
+ }
+ html.replace("<code>", "<div class=\"preformatted
panel\" style=\"border-width: 1px;\">\n" +
+ " <div class=\"preformattedContent
panelContent\">\n" +
+ " <pre class=\"code-java\">\n" +
+ " <code>");
+ html.replace("</code>", "</code>\n" +
+ " </pre>\n" +
+ " </div>\n" +
+ " </div>");
break;
} catch (IOException e) {
LOGGER.warn("can't read readme file for example " +
example.getName());